Output 821ebaeddf70de2747a208e86def7907f2e1ee75fc1d1bdd5f6380115536ebca:0

value
103856754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20150d69d18885cfc7a80dc8d0ee4a96f1fc2a16 OP_EQUAL
address
34cemRoXDooBN65f5kWVN9m51RkZeinFpw
transaction
821ebaeddf70de2747a208e86def7907f2e1ee75fc1d1bdd5f6380115536ebca
spent
true